In the letter read above, the Director General of Police has stated that the 48th All India Police Duty Meet was held at Dergaon (Assam) from 14th to 18th December 2004. In the Meet, 21 states, 8 Central Police Organizations and 1 UT participated in six events (Scientific Aids to Investigation (SAI), Computer Awareness, Dog Squad, Anti Sabotage Check, Videography and Professional Photography). In the Meet, the Tamil Nadu Police contingent has bagged the maximum number of medals (11) comprising two Gold Medals (SAI and Computer), 4 Silver medals (Computers & SAI) and 5 Bronze medals (Professional Photography, Videography and SAI). The Tamil Nadu Police contingent has also bagged the highest number of Trophies - Two Winners Trophies (Scientific Aids to investigation and Computer Awareness) and one Runners Up Trophy (Scientific Aids to Investigation). Tamil Nadu Police contingent also stands first in the total tally of marks, with a score of 3488.97.

2. He has further reported that as per G.O (MS) No.1087 Home (Police VII) Department, dated 07.09.2004, the Government has fixed the quantum of cash reward as follows:- 1. Gold Medalist - Rs.50,000/-

2. Silver Medalist - Rs.30,000/-

3. Bronze Medalist - Rs.20,000/-
